Elements and Performance Criteria

1

Identify security risk situation.

1.1

Applicable provisions of legislative and organisational requirements relevant to security risk operations are identified and complied with.

1.2

Potential security risk situation is identified and assessed for degree of risk to self, others, property and premises.

1.3

Environmental factors are monitored and changes in characteristics that may impact on security risk situation are identified.

1.4

Occupational Health and Safety (OHS) requirements are identified and appropriate risk control measures to ensure safety of self and others are implemented.

1.5

Requirements for advice or assistance are identified and requested from relevant persons in accordance with organisational procedures.

2

Respond to security risk situation.

2.1

Appropriate response to identified security risk situation is determined and implemented in accordance with organisational procedures.

2.2

Response initiative maximises the safety and security of self, others, property and premises and is carried out within the scope of own responsibility, competence and authority.

2.3

Equipment is usedin accordance with manufacturer’s instructions and organisational procedures.

2.4

Appropriate interpersonaltechniques and communication channels are used in accordance with organisational procedures.

2.5

Details of security risk situation are documented and maintained in accordance with organisational procedures.

3

Assist in the review of the response to security risk situation.

3.1

Participation in review and debrief processes are carried out in accordance with organisational procedures.

3.2

Observations are accurate and provided in a clear, concise and constructive manner.

3.3

Effects of stress and other issues related to own well-being are recognised and controlled using appropriate stress management techniques.

3.4

Review and debrief findings identify areas for improving future response procedures and reducing effects of stress.

3.5

Relevant documentation is completed and securely maintained with due regard to confidentiality in accordance with organisational procedures.
